Gettin’ Cheeky

We loved Kristin Chenoweth for her portrayal of the Good Witch in Broadway’s Wicked, and now we love her even more for showing wicked middle Americans that intolerance is something up with which she will not put.

Kristin Chenoweth

Though she had been scheduled to appear in the Women of Faith concert in November in Oklahoma City, she got disinvited when those Women of Faith learned of her attitude towards gay people. Kristin had said: “I am a Christian and I don’t want there to be any confusion about what I believe or who I am. I don’t believe gay people are going to hell. I believe that judgment is left to the one upstairs and I believe Jesus is all about love.”

Apparently, the Women of Faith don’t believe Jesus is all about love. Turning the other cheek has never had more relevance, and we certainly turn out all our cheeks at those ladies in Oklahoma. What kind of doofus gives up a chance to hear Kristin Chenoweth sing, anyhow?
